Output 3aea07c8e72ae5c75c3632f4e76eb3d42b8cb2f5556cb966f529ed4a1cf54ae2:2

value
68792666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520e11985d3bd69593bb431f54adbac817ac5005 OP_EQUAL
address
MFP2VfykZTCp3HLGFEu5aHaf5WWom3BvkY
transaction
3aea07c8e72ae5c75c3632f4e76eb3d42b8cb2f5556cb966f529ed4a1cf54ae2
spent
true